What is the AFPSAT IRF?
The Armed Forces of the Philippines Service Aptitude Test (AFPSAT) Individual Result Form (IRF) is a computer-generated form given to an individual AFPSAT passer that contains the status and breakdown of result per subtest. It serves as proof that you already passed the AFPSAT.
It can be used when applying to another branch of Services like in the Army, Navy, or the Marines as long as within the AFP only. It is valid for three (3) years starting from the date of the examination. However, if you don’t have plans to apply at the other branch of AFP, only in the PAF, you won’t need this since your records are kept in the PAF database.
Who can request for AFPSAT IRF?
Applicants who already took their AFPSAT at the Philippine Air Force and would like to apply to other AFP Branch of Service. Only those who passed the Examination will be provided with an AFPSAT IRF, those who failed will not be given the IRF.
You can only request once. If your AFPSAT IRF is lost, you will need an Affidavit of Loss to claim the new one.
How to request AFPSAT Individual Result Form (IRF)?
You can request it in 3 different ways. First at the PAFHRMC Testing Branch, second via letter at the nearest PAF Processing Center and the third one via the online method.
Below is the process on how to request it online.
- Visit the link https://forms.gle/YAsCcKuaxH42F61U7.
- Fill up the required information in the google form.
- Wait for the confirmation of your request and the notice of availability.
- Bring two valid ID’s and AFPSAT claim stub (the one detached during the exam) on the day of your claim. If you lost your stub, two valid ID’s will do.
Things to remember:
AFPSAT IRF is free of charge. There is no cost in requesting or claiming it. Moreover, you can only request your AFPSAT IRF at the branch service you took the AFPSAT.
